According to Statista, freelance workers are expected to make up the majority of the U.S. workforce by 2027. As the gig economy continues to grow, more business owners are recognizing the value of tapping into freelance talent.

Hiring freelance workers offers several advantages, including access to specialized skills and the ability to scale your workforce up or down as needed, increasing overall business agility. If you’re considering integrating freelancers into your organization, here’s how doing so can impact your workplace.

Increased Flexibility

One of the most significant benefits of the gig economy is its ability to expand your talent pool. Access to top-tier talent ultimately strengthens your bottom line while encouraging the creation of a more flexible work environment.

Freelancers highly value flexible schedules and workspaces. Many prefer operating within a virtual office environment rather than commuting to a physical location every day. Offering flexible workspace options helps attract skilled freelancers while supporting modern work preferences.

Streamlined Communication and Collaboration

Incorporating freelance workers also accelerates digital transformation within your business. Since freelancers often work remotely, companies must invest in reliable communication and collaboration tools that support teamwork across locations.

Upgrading your communications technology makes it easier to collaborate with freelancers anywhere in the world. Clear, convenient communication ensures everyone stays aligned, improves efficiency, and allows projects to move forward at a faster pace.

Reduced Operating Costs

Hiring freelancers can significantly reduce workplace overhead costs. Virtual offices require fewer resources than traditional physical offices, helping businesses lower expenses related to rent, utilities, maintenance, and taxes.

Additionally, businesses no longer need to secure extra physical space every time they expand their workforce. Freelancers also benefit by avoiding daily commutes, increasing job satisfaction and productivity. This creates a win-win situation for both businesses and freelance professionals.
